Understanding Engine Oil: Role, Importance, Classification, and Models

Engine oil is a lubricant that serves a crucial role in the proper functioning of an internal combustion engine. It plays a vital role in reducing friction between moving parts, which helps in minimizing wear and tear, dissipating heat, and preventing corrosion within the engine. Engine oil also helps in sealing the gaps between the cylinder walls, piston rings, and valves, ensuring optimal performance and longevity of the engine.

Role and Importance of Engine Oil:

The primary role of engine oil is to lubricate the moving parts within the engine, reducing friction and heat generated during operation. This lubrication is essential for preventing metal-to-metal contact, which can lead to premature wear and damage to engine components. Engine oil also helps in carrying contaminants and deposits away from critical engine parts, maintaining a clean environment within the engine.

Furthermore, engine oil acts as a sealant, preventing leaks and maintaining proper pressure levels within the engine. It also provides a protective barrier against rust and corrosion, extending the lifespan of the engine components. Regularly changing the engine oil as per the manufacturer's recommendations is crucial for ensuring optimal engine performance and longevity.

Classification Methods and Differences of Engine Oil:

Engine oils are classified based on their viscosity and performance characteristics. Viscosity refers to the oil's resistance to flow at different temperatures. The Society of Automotive Engineers (SAE) has developed a classification system for engine oils based on viscosity grades, such as 5W-20, 10W-30, or 15W-40.

The first number in the viscosity grade, such as 5W, indicates the oil's flow characteristics during cold starting conditions. The lower the number, the better the oil's cold-start flow properties. The second number, such as 20, 30, or 40, represents the oil's viscosity at operating temperatures. Lower viscosity oils provide better fuel economy, while higher viscosity oils offer enhanced engine protection at high temperatures.

Interpreting Engine Oil Models (e.g., 5W-20):

In the example of 5W-20 engine oil:

The "5W" indicates the oil's winter viscosity grade, referring to its flow properties in cold temperatures. A lower winter viscosity grade ensures easier starts in cold weather.
The "20" represents the oil's viscosity grade at operating temperatures. A lower number indicates a lighter oil that provides better fuel economy.
Understanding the meaning of engine oil models is essential for selecting the right oil for your vehicle based on the manufacturer's recommendations and prevailing weather conditions.

In conclusion, engine oil plays a critical role in maintaining the health and performance of an internal combustion engine. By understanding the role, importance, classification methods, and interpreting engine oil models, vehicle owners can make informed decisions regarding oil selection and maintenance practices to ensure the longevity and efficiency of their engines. Regular maintenance and adherence to recommended oil change intervals are key to maximizing engine performance and durability.
